This was from a Bills fan that had traveled here to Arrowhead to see the game.

Originally Posted by :
“Well, I’m beginning to crawl my way out of depression. Man, I was low last night. I went from crying tears of joy to feeling all the life in my body just leave. One of the best football games ever. And the Buffalo Bills lost. Again. Having Patrick Mahomes, Tyreek Hill & Travis Kelce on the same team coaches by Andy Reid should be illegal. Seriously. If Josh Allen isn’t the best football player on the planet, Mahomes is. F that guy is unreal. Being in Arrowhead was surreal. The home field advantage Kansas City has is not unwarranted. You guys are fn crazy. My ears are still ringing. I can’t believe the Bills found a way to blow it at the end. I should be able to because we are the best in the world at finding ways to lose huge games. But man, prevent defense against the best offense on the planet with 3 timeouts and only needing a field goal is one of the most colossal coaching failures of all time. I know you all are very proud of your city and your team. And you darn well should be. The hospitality my friends and I received all weekend was world class. Oddly enough, I think that being in Kansas City, surrounded by Chiefs fans is what helped me avoid crumbling into a horrible state of depression last night. So many people came up to me to congratulate me on a great game. They demanded that I keep my head up because the performance by the Bills and Josh Allen was spectacular. I was pretty much told I would be an absolute fool to talk down on the Bills after that game. And Josh Allen in a universal superstar. I really needed to hear that. Kansas City, you are beautiful. I had high expectations coming in to this trip. They were wayyyy exceeded. The people in this city are absolutely phenomenal. Thank you all so much for making us feel so welcome this whole time. Even with the gut wrenching loss, this was an all time experience. Now, go win the whole fn thing! I love you guys! GO BILLS!!!”
